What Does the Warranty Cover?

Imagine your faucet starts leaking after only a few months. Water is dripping everywhere! You are worried about wasting water. And about the cost of fixing it. Luckily, Moen’s warranty might help. It covers problems with the faucet’s parts. If a part is faulty, Moen will replace it for free. This includes things like cartridges and handles. It also covers the finish of the faucet. If the finish peels or fades, Moen will fix it. The warranty covers normal use. But it does not cover damage from misuse. Or from not following the instructions. Always install your faucet correctly. And take good care of it. This helps you keep your warranty valid.

What Voids the Moen Warranty?

Did you know that some things can make your warranty invalid? It’s true! If you don’t follow Moen’s instructions, your warranty might not be good. Using the wrong cleaning products can damage the finish. This is not covered. If you change the faucet in any way, the warranty might be void. If you use the faucet in a way it was not meant to be used, that’s a problem. The warranty is for normal household use. So, be careful! Treat your faucet well. And follow the rules. This helps you keep your warranty safe.

How to Make a Warranty Claim?

Making a warranty claim might seem hard. But it’s not! First, gather your information. Find your proof of purchase. This can be a receipt or an online order. Then, contact Moen’s customer service. You can call them. Or you can visit their website. Explain the problem with your faucet. Be ready to answer questions. Moen might ask for pictures of the problem. They want to see what’s wrong. If your claim is valid, Moen will send you a replacement part. Or, they might send a whole new faucet! Then, you can fix your sink and stop the drips.

Scenario Covered by Warranty? Notes
Faucet leaks due to faulty cartridge Yes Must have proof of purchase and be original homeowner
Finish peels or fades prematurely Yes Applies to normal use, not chemical damage
Handle breaks off during normal use Yes Inspect for signs of misuse
You accidentally break the faucet No Warranty does not cover accidental damage
You use abrasive cleaners and damage the finish No Follow Moen’s cleaning instructions

What if the Faucet is Discontinued?

Sometimes, Moen stops making a certain faucet model. This is called discontinued. If your faucet is discontinued, Moen might not have the exact replacement parts. But they will still help you. They might offer a similar faucet. Or they might offer a credit towards a new faucet. They want to make sure you are happy. Even if they can’t give you the exact same thing. They will find a solution.

What About Labor Costs for Installation?

Moen’s warranty usually covers the faucet itself. It doesn’t usually cover labor costs. This means you might have to pay a plumber to install the new faucet. Even if Moen sends it for free. This is something to keep in mind. Labor costs can be expensive. But getting a free faucet is still a good deal. You just have to factor in the installation cost.
